Abstract

Children with fragile X syndrome (FXS) exhibit deficits in a variety of cognitive processes within the executive function domain. As working memory (WM) is known to support a wide range of cognitive, learning and adaptive functions, WM computer-based training programs have the potential to benefit people with FXS and other forms of intellectual and developmental disability (IDD). However, research on the effectiveness of WM training has been mixed. The current study is a follow-up "deep dive" into the data collected during a randomized controlled trial of Cogmed (Stockholm, Sweden) WM training in children with FXS. Analyses characterized the training data, identified training quality metrics, and identified subgroups of participants with similar training patterns. Child, parent, home environment and training quality metrics were explored in relation to the clinical outcomes during the WM training intervention. Baseline cognitive level and training behavior metrics were linked to gains in WM performance-based assessments and also to reductions in inattention and other behaviors related to executive functioning during the intervention. The results also support a recommendation that future cognitive intervention trials with individuals with IDD such as FXS include additional screening of participants to determine not only baseline feasibility, but also capacity for training progress over a short period prior to inclusion and randomization. This practice may also better identify individuals with IDD who are more likely to benefit from cognitive training in clinical and educational settings.

摘要

脆性X综合征(FXS)患儿在执行功能领域的多种认知过程中存在缺陷。由于工作记忆(WM)已知可支持广泛的认知、学习和适应功能,基于计算机的WM训练计划有可能使FXS患者以及其他形式的智力和发育障碍(IDD)患者受益。然而,关于WM训练有效性的研究结果不一。当前的研究是对在一项针对FXS患儿的Cogmed(瑞典斯德哥尔摩)WM训练随机对照试验期间收集的数据进行的后续“深入研究”。分析对训练数据进行了特征描述,确定了训练质量指标,并确定了具有相似训练模式的参与者亚组。在WM训练干预期间,探讨了儿童、家长、家庭环境和训练质量指标与临床结果之间的关系。基线认知水平和训练行为指标与基于WM表现的评估中的增益相关,也与干预期间注意力不集中及其他与执行功能相关行为的减少相关。研究结果还支持一项建议,即未来针对FXS等IDD个体的认知干预试验应包括对参与者进行额外筛查,不仅要确定基线可行性,还要在纳入和随机分组之前的短时间内确定训练进展的能力。这种做法还可能更好地识别出在临床和教育环境中更有可能从认知训练中受益的IDD个体。
